If you are using your school's computer, on your school's network, and you have "agreed" to the school's policy for Internet usage, you are at risk of being SUSPENDED or EXPELLED from school, should you try to violate their policies.
If you are using your employer's computer, on your employer's network, you could be SUSPENDED or FIRED if you try to violate their policies.
So, the only solution is to use your own computer, and purchase a USB device from your cell-phone company -- it allows you to carry your Internet traffic over the cell-phone's cellular network.
So, if there is cell-phone coverage where you are, you have Internet access using your *OWN* computer.
